Real-time QR code tracking and analytics

Track QR code scans in real time, see when, where and how often

Monitor every scan with detailed QR code analytics. Know exactly when people engage with your QR codes, where they are scanning from, and which devices they use. No technical setup. No waiting for reports.

Real-time QR code tracking for every campaign,
capturing each scan as it happens and surfacing it in your dashboard within seconds. Track QR codes across print ads, packaging, events, and digital channels from a single view, and watch campaign trends emerge as scans roll in.
Geographic insights that reveal where scans come from,
with country and city data on every scan. Identify the markets that drive the most engagement and tailor your campaigns to the regions that matter most.
Device and browser analytics for every scan,
showing whether your audience scans from iOS, Android, desktop, or other platforms. Optimize your landing pages and hosted content for the devices your visitors actually use.
Start tracking QR codes free

No credit card required. Start free, upgrade when you need more.

Twilee QR code tracking dashboard showing scan analytics, country breakdown and device insights

How QR code tracking works with Twilee

With Twilee, tracking QR codes is simple. Every time someone scans your QR code, our system captures data about that scan and pushes it to your dashboard within seconds. You get instant insights into QR code performance with no technical setup.

  1. 1 Create a QR code with Twilee.
  2. 2 Share it on marketing materials, products, packaging, or digital channels.
  3. 3 Every scan is tracked automatically through our redirect service.
  4. 4 View up-to-date analytics in your dashboard within seconds.
  5. 5 Optimize your campaigns based on real performance data.

That is it. Start tracking QR code scans in seconds. Twilee is built on dynamic QR codes, which is how every scan gets routed through our service and reported back to you.

What you can track with QR code analytics

Your QR code tracking dashboard gives you clear visibility into every scan:

  • Total scans: how many times each QR code has been scanned.
  • Scan location: track QR code scans by country and city.
  • Device type: see whether scans come from mobile, tablet, or desktop.
  • Operating system: identify iOS, Android, Windows, macOS, and more.
  • Browser: know which browsers your audience uses.
  • Scan date and time: see exactly when each scan happens.
  • Scan frequency: identify peak scanning windows and traffic patterns over time.

All tracking data updates within seconds of a scan. No delays. No complicated reports.

Your real-time QR code tracking dashboard

Your Twilee dashboard shows all your QR code tracking data in one place. Scan data appears within seconds, so you can keep an eye on active campaigns and drill into the metrics that matter most.

  • Country breakdown: visualize top scan locations with clear charts.
  • Device and OS breakdown: understand the platforms behind every scan.
  • Scan frequency timeline: spot peak windows and traffic patterns over time.
  • Per QR code activity: drill into the statistics of any individual QR code.
  • CSV and XLSX export: download scan data for reporting, sharing, or further analysis.

Send every QR code scan to Google Analytics 4

Twilee can forward every QR code scan directly to your Google Analytics 4 property via the GA4 Measurement Protocol. See QR code scans alongside your other marketing channels in a single GA4 view, with automatic geographic data, traffic attribution (source: twilee, medium: qr_code), and QR code metadata attached to every event.

Configure your GA4 Measurement ID and API secret in your team settings, and Twilee takes care of the rest. Every new scan triggers a GA4 event ready for analysis.

Google Analytics 4 forwarding is available from the Premium plan.

Why track QR codes? Real-world use cases

QR code tracking helps you measure what matters. Businesses of every size use Twilee to drive results across many scenarios:

Marketing campaigns

Track QR codes on print ads, billboards, flyers, and social media. See which campaigns drive the most engagement and adjust your strategy based on real scan data.

Event check-ins

Use QR codes at events to track arrivals. Know how many attendees showed up, when they arrived, and which session entrances were busiest.

Product launches

Monitor how many customers scan the QR code on your product or packaging. Measure interest in real time and adjust marketing or inventory based on demand signals.

Packaging and retail

Track QR codes on packaging, receipts, and in-store displays. Understand how shoppers interact with your brand long after they leave the store.

Asset and inventory tracking

Track QR codes on equipment, inventory, or tools. Know when and where assets are scanned for better logistics, maintenance, and management.

Free QR code tracking, no credit card required

Start tracking QR codes for free today. Twilee gives you access to the full analytics dashboard, location and device insights, and no credit card at signup. Upgrade when you need longer scan retention, data export, Google Analytics 4 forwarding, or API access. See all Twilee plans and features.

Frequently asked questions

Common questions about QR code tracking and analytics.

What data is tracked when someone scans my QR code?

Each scan records the timestamp, approximate geographic location (city and country), device type, operating system, and browser. All data is collected in compliance with GDPR and privacy regulations.

Can I track scans on static QR codes?

No. Scan tracking requires dynamic QR codes, which route through our servers before redirecting. Static QR codes encode data directly and bypass our servers entirely, so no analytics are possible.

Is the tracking data available in real time?

Yes. Scan data appears in your dashboard within seconds of each scan, so you can monitor campaigns as they happen and export reports at any time.

Is QR code tracking free?

Yes. Twilee lets you start tracking QR codes for free, with access to the full analytics dashboard and no credit card required at signup. Upgrade when you need longer retention, data export, Google Analytics 4 forwarding, or API access.

Can I track QR codes I created elsewhere?

No. To track QR code scans with Twilee, the QR code must be created on Twilee. Dynamic QR codes route through our redirect service, which is how scan data is captured and reported.

Can I export my analytics data?

Yes. You can export scan logs and analytics reports as CSV or XLSX from your dashboard, making it easy to share results with your team or pull the data into external reporting tools. Data export is available from the Premium plan.

How long is my scan tracking data kept?

Scan history is retained for the duration of your plan. Higher plans include longer retention windows, so upgrade if you need to analyze long-term trends and historical campaign performance.

How does the Google Analytics 4 integration work?

When enabled, each QR code scan sends an event to your GA4 property via the Measurement Protocol. The event includes QR code metadata, geographic location, and traffic attribution (source: twilee, medium: qr_code). You configure your GA4 Measurement ID and API secret in the team settings. This feature is available from the Premium plan.